  6. As a test of faith, God tells Abraham to sacrifice his son, Isaac, atop a mountain ("Highway 61" in Dylan's song). When Abraham reluctantly complies, God rewards him by refusing to accept the sacrifice and instead promises to bless him and all of his descendants.
